bitFlyer(ビットフライヤー)で自動売買を始めるための手順と注意点



bitFlyer(ビットフライヤー)で自動売買を始めるための手順と注意点


bitFlyer(ビットフライヤー)で自動売買を始めるための手順と注意点

bitFlyerは、日本で最も歴史のある仮想通貨取引所の一つであり、多くのトレーダーに利用されています。近年、自動売買(自動取引)の需要が高まっており、bitFlyerでもAPIを利用した自動売買が可能です。本稿では、bitFlyerで自動売買を始めるための手順と注意点を詳細に解説します。

1. 自動売買の基礎知識

自動売買とは、あらかじめ設定した条件に基づいて、コンピュータープログラムが自動的に仮想通貨の売買を行う仕組みです。人間の感情に左右されず、24時間体制で取引を行うことができるため、効率的な取引が期待できます。自動売買を行うためには、以下の要素が必要です。

  • 取引所API: bitFlyerなどの取引所が提供するAPIを利用して、取引所のデータにアクセスし、注文を発行します。
  • 自動売買ツール: APIを利用して取引を行うためのソフトウェアです。市販のツールを利用することも、自作することも可能です。
  • 取引戦略: どのような条件で売買を行うかを定義したものです。テクニカル分析やファンダメンタルズ分析に基づいて作成します。
  • サーバー環境: 自動売買ツールを稼働させるためのサーバー環境が必要です。

2. bitFlyer APIの利用準備

bitFlyerで自動売買を行うためには、まずAPIキーを取得する必要があります。以下の手順でAPIキーを取得します。

  1. bitFlyerアカウントにログインします。
  2. 「API」のページにアクセスします。(通常、アカウント設定の中にあります。)
  3. APIキーの利用規約を確認し、同意します。
  4. APIキーとシークレットキーを生成します。
  5. APIキーの権限を設定します。自動売買に必要な権限(取引、注文照会など)を適切に設定してください。

注意点: APIキーとシークレットキーは、厳重に管理してください。漏洩すると不正アクセスを受ける可能性があります。また、APIキーの権限は、必要最小限に設定するように心がけてください。

3. 自動売買ツールの選定と設定

bitFlyer APIを利用するための自動売買ツールは、様々な種類があります。市販のツールを利用する場合は、以下の点を考慮して選定してください。

  • 対応取引所: bitFlyerに対応しているか。
  • 機能: 必要な機能(バックテスト、リアルタイム取引、注文管理など)が備わっているか。
  • 使いやすさ: 直感的に操作できるか。
  • セキュリティ: セキュリティ対策がしっかりしているか。
  • サポート: サポート体制が充実しているか。

自作する場合は、プログラミングの知識が必要になります。PythonやJavaなどのプログラミング言語を使用して、bitFlyer APIにアクセスし、取引を行うプログラムを作成します。bitFlyerは、APIドキュメントを公開しているので、参考にしてください。

自動売買ツールを設定する際には、以下の点に注意してください。

  • APIキーの設定: 取得したAPIキーとシークレットキーを正しく設定します。
  • 取引ペアの設定: 取引したい仮想通貨ペアを設定します。
  • 取引戦略の設定: どのような条件で売買を行うかを設定します。
  • リスク管理の設定: 損失を限定するためのストップロスやテイクプロフィットなどの設定を行います。

4. 取引戦略の構築

自動売買の成否は、取引戦略にかかっています。効果的な取引戦略を構築するためには、以下の点を考慮してください。

  • テクニカル分析: チャート分析を行い、売買のタイミングを見極めます。移動平均線、MACD、RSIなどのテクニカル指標を活用します。
  • ファンダメンタルズ分析: 仮想通貨の基礎的な情報(技術、チーム、市場動向など)を分析し、将来的な価格変動を予測します。
  • バックテスト: 過去のデータを使用して、取引戦略の有効性を検証します。
  • リスク管理: 損失を限定するためのストップロスやテイクプロフィットなどの設定を行います。

取引戦略は、市場の状況に合わせて常に改善していく必要があります。バックテストの結果を分析し、パラメータを調整したり、新しい指標を追加したりすることで、より効果的な取引戦略を構築することができます。

5. 自動売買の実行と監視

自動売買ツールを設定し、取引戦略を構築したら、いよいよ自動売買を実行します。自動売買を実行する際には、以下の点に注意してください。

  • 少額から始める: 最初は少額の資金で自動売買を行い、徐々に取引量を増やしていくようにします。
  • リアルタイム監視: 自動売買ツールが正常に動作しているか、リアルタイムで監視します。
  • ログの確認: 自動売買ツールのログを確認し、エラーが発生していないか、取引が正常に行われているかを確認します。
  • 市場の状況の変化に対応: 市場の状況は常に変化します。取引戦略を定期的に見直し、市場の変化に対応できるように調整します。

自動売買は、一度設定すれば自動的に取引を行ってくれる便利な仕組みですが、常に監視し、必要に応じて調整を行うことが重要です。

6. bitFlyer自動売買における注意点

bitFlyerで自動売買を行う際には、以下の点に注意してください。

  • API制限: bitFlyer APIには、リクエスト数の制限があります。制限を超えるとAPIが利用できなくなるため、注意が必要です。
  • 取引手数料: bitFlyerでは、取引ごとに手数料が発生します。手数料を考慮して、取引戦略を構築する必要があります。
  • スリッページ: 注文価格と約定価格の間にずれが生じる現象です。スリッページが発生すると、予想していた利益が得られない可能性があります。
  • 流動性: 取引量が少ない仮想通貨ペアでは、スリッページが発生しやすくなります。流動性の高い仮想通貨ペアを選ぶようにしましょう。
  • セキュリティ: APIキーの管理、自動売買ツールのセキュリティ対策など、セキュリティには十分注意してください。

7. 自動売買のリスク

自動売買は、効率的な取引を可能にする一方で、いくつかのリスクも伴います。

  • システム障害: 自動売買ツールやサーバーに障害が発生すると、取引が停止したり、誤った注文が発注されたりする可能性があります。
  • 取引戦略の誤り: 取引戦略に誤りがあると、損失が発生する可能性があります。
  • 市場の急変: 市場が急変すると、取引戦略が機能しなくなり、損失が発生する可能性があります。
  • ハッキング: 自動売買ツールやアカウントがハッキングされると、資金が盗まれる可能性があります。

これらのリスクを理解した上で、自動売買を行うようにしましょう。

まとめ

bitFlyerで自動売買を始めるためには、APIキーの取得、自動売買ツールの選定と設定、取引戦略の構築、自動売買の実行と監視が必要です。自動売買は、効率的な取引を可能にする一方で、いくつかのリスクも伴います。リスクを理解した上で、慎重に自動売買を行うようにしましょう。常に市場の状況を監視し、取引戦略を改善していくことが、自動売買で成功するための鍵となります。


前の記事

カルダノ(ADA)今から始める初心者向け投資講座

次の記事

暗号資産(仮想通貨)の安全な保管方法とおすすめ機器